AI Demand Pro has appointed Aaron Davies as its new chief executive officer, signaling a push to accelerate growth and expand adoption of its AI-powered platform for personal injury law firms.
Davies brings nearly two decades of experience in emerging technologies, product development, and global partnerships. He joins the company after a 12-year tenure at Meta, where he most recently served as director of Oculus Publishing. As an early member of the Oculus team, he played a key role in scaling the business from startup to a category-defining company, culminating in its $2 billion acquisition.
He succeeds Travis Easton, who will transition to founder and president while continuing to support the company’s strategic direction.
AI Demand Pro helps personal injury law firms generate settlement-ready demand packages in minutes rather than days. The platform uses AI to organize medical and legal data into structured, persuasive narratives, improving efficiency and case outcomes while reducing the need for additional staffing.
In his new role, Davies will prioritize expanding product capabilities, driving broader adoption across law firms, and scaling the platform’s impact across the legal industry.
